About the team
The Child & Adolescent Health Unit takes around 5,000 admissions per year and provides a regional referral service, including an 8-bed Special Care Nursery with neonates >32 weeks. It is staffed by eight paediatricians, ten registrars/PHOs, six junior staff, and visiting medical and surgical specialists. Telehealth is used to assist families and reduce travel.
